Mother's Day Craft

Flower

Mother's Day Flower
What you need:
Egg carton
Paint
PVA glue
Pom Pom
Pipe Cleaners

What you do:

  1. Cut one section off the egg carton. This will form the flower.
  2. Paint both sides of the flower.  Let dry.
  3. Twist the pipe cleaner to form the stem and another one to form leaves.
  4. Push the pipe cleaner through the bottom of the flower and twist around to hold in place.
  5. Glue a pom pom in the centre of the flower.

Hand Print Love Heart Wreath
Hand Print Love Heart Wreath
What you need:
Paint
Scissors
Glue
Hands!

What you do:
  1. Paint the child's hand and make a number of hand prints.
  2. Once dry, cut the hand prints out (older children can do this themselves).
  3. Assemble into a Love Heart shape and glue them in place.
  4. Write a special message or poem in one of the hand prints.
This craft is great for a variety of ages.  

Sidewalk Chalk Art


Sidewalk Chalk - reposted from Facebook from Mommas Helping Mommas
1 Tablespoon flour
10 drops of food colouring
Half a cup of warm water

Place in spray bottle and shake.  Spray the concrete, pavers or even hang up a large piece of paper outdoors and watch the kids go nuts!  Always a favourite.
